 In a certain town, 25% families own a phone and families 15% own a car, 65% families own neither a phone nor a car. 2000 families own both a car and a phone. Consider the following statements in this regard: 

1. 10%  families own both a car and a phone. 

2. 35%  families own either a car or a phone. 

3. 40,000 families live in the town.

Which of the above statements are correct?

Detailed Solution

  n(P)=25%,n(C)=15% , nPcCc=65%,n(PC)=2000

nPcCc=65% n(PC)c=65% n(PC)=35% Now n(PC)=n(P)+n(C)n(PC) 35=25+15n(PC) n(PC)=4035=5 5% of the total =2000

  Total number of families =2000×1005=40000

Therefore, statements 2 and 3 are correct.
